Transfer data software from Xp to 7
I use Panasonic Photofun Studio on Windows Xp computer for manage and classify images. I buy a new computer with Windows 7 and want to transfer database information on the new computer. In Windows Xp I take "C:\Documents and Settings\Username\Application Data\Panasonic\phdb\username.mdb" and if I put it in a other computer with Windows Xp to same folder, it's working fine. But I am not able to do it with Windows 7 because folder junction point. Somebody have cue for me?

Try using the folder %appdata%\Panasonic\phdb to store username.mdb. This will translate to C:\Users\username\AppData\Roaming\Panasonic\phdb

Roaming do not include Panasonic. I start the Photofun Studio software with the user and the folder is created. Now I can put the mdb in the good folder. But the software ask for administrator right. Thank for your help
